Bamboo Delight is a website that purports to host a synthesis of Chinese and "Aryan" healing knowledge, using terms such as Kung Fu, Falun Gong and acupuncture, and publishing a weekly Chinese Swaztika Newsletter (until July 2005). Unlike most health websites, however, it includes numerous statements and articles that deride Jews, and have little or absolutely nothing to do with health, let alone Chinese medicine. This is especially evident upon exploration of the inner pages on the site. Some articles also lean against other non-White peoples, ironically including the Chinese themselves. The ADL claims that the website has some association with white nationalist and Stormfront.org administrator Don Black [661], but this is disputed in the light of the whois report on the website's domain name.
